Panther carcass found; second in as many days
The News-Press staff
The state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ission said Sunday it has recovered the carcass of a Florida panther along Alligator Alley in Collier County.
The 5- or 6-year-old male was found at mile marker 95, about three miles from the end of the highway's
wildlife fencing. The cause of death was collision with a vehicle; it was the fourth panther death of 2015
On Saturday, the carcass of a 4-year-old male was found near Interstate 75's mile marker 132, which is near Daniels Parkway in Lee County.
